   A case of squamous cell carcinoma of the skin subsequent to a subcutaneous foreign body

چکیده    Squamous cell carcinoma (scc) of the skin is one of the most common non melanoma skin cancers (nmsc), along with basal cell carcinoma (bcc). besides ultraviolet radiation, exposure to industrial agents, ionizing radiation, and areas of chronic inflammation are associated with the development of scc. squamous cell carcinoma may also be associated with foreign bodies. we report a rare case of cutaneous scc in an elderly kashmiri female, which was developed subsequent to a subcutaneous non metallic foreign body and was successfully excised with negative margins and transposition flap closure.
